Trip Overview

Evanston to Marbleton is 123.4 miles and takes about 2 hours 16 minutes via US Highway 189, with a fuel budget near $20 and enough daylight to finish in a day. This trip stays within Wyoming, connecting two points in the Mountain West region. You'll be spending most of your time on highways, making for a straightforward drive. With no planned stops, this is a quick and efficient route if you're looking to cover ground without much fuss. Plan for a simple, direct transit between these two Wyoming communities.

Trip Plan

Given the 2 hour 16 minute drive time, departing in the morning allows for ample daylight and flexibility. Since there are no recommended stops and the drive is under three hours, you can easily complete this in a single day without feeling rushed. Keep an eye on your fuel, especially as you get closer to Marbleton, as services can be spread out in this region. The primary route, US Highway 189, is generally well-maintained, but always check local conditions before you depart, especially during winter months. Your fuel cost is estimated at $20, so plan accordingly.
